I have the information you need. In QuickBooks Online, you have the option to automate the invoice reminders. 

 

Here's how:

 

  1. Go to Settings > Account and Settings.
  2. On the left panel, click Sales.
  3. Scroll down to the Reminders section and enable the Auto invoice reminders button.
  4. Enter the subject line and and email message. You can also stick with the default message. Tip: We recommend you keep "reminder" in the subject.
  5. Hit Save and then Done.
